The Science Behind Respirators: Filtration and Function

Respirators are essential tools designed to protect the wearer from inhaling harmful substances. These gadgets function by utilizing a combination of techniques that effectively filter and block airborne contaminants.

The central component of a respirator is the filter, which acts as a barrier against inhaled particles. These filters are typically constructed from materials of various textures that effectively capture contaminants based on their size and traits.

For example, P100 filters, widely recognized for their high capacity, utilize a dense network of filaments to efficiently trap even the microscopic airborne particles.

In addition to filtration, respirators may incorporate breathing systems to regulate the flow of air through the apparatus. This ensures a consistent and comfortable breathing experience for the wearer while maintaining the integrity of the filtration process.

Selecting a Respirator: Your Guide to Optimal Protection

When it comes to respiratory protection, selecting a suitable respirator is paramount. Factors such as the type of hazard, task at hand and individual needs must be carefully considered. A poorly fitting respirator can compromise your safety, while a well-fitted one provides a vital barrier.

A fundamental step in respirator selection is identifying the specific hazards you face. Fumes require different types of respirators, so understanding the nature of the threat is crucial. Refer to safety data sheets (SDS) and industry regulations to fully identify the required level of protection.
